According to Transpire Insight The global healthcare landscape is undergoing a revolutionary shift from small-molecule chemical drugs to complex biological therapies. Biologics, derived from living organisms, represent the frontier of modern medicine, providing highly targeted and effective treatments for previously untreatable conditions.

Market Overview

  • The Paradigm Shift: The biologics manufacturing market involves the complex production of therapeutics such as monoclonal antibodies (mAbs), vaccines, recombinant proteins, and advanced cell and gene therapies.
  • Manufacturing Complexity: Unlike traditional chemically synthesized drugs, biologics manufacturing demands sophisticated living cell cultures, stringent environmental controls, and multi-stage purification techniques.
  • Strategic Outsourcing: Because establishing in-house manufacturing facilities requires immense capital expenditure and technical expertise, pharmaceutical innovators increasingly rely on specialized Contract Development and Manufacturing Organizations (CDMOs).

Key Market Trends & Insights

  • Dominance of Monoclonal Antibodies (mAbs): Monoclonal antibodies remain the largest product segment, heavily utilized in oncology and autoimmune treatments due to their high specificity.
  • Rise of Next-Generation Biologics: There is an unprecedented acceleration in the development of cell and gene therapies, requiring advanced viral vector manufacturing capacities.
  • Technological Innovation: The industry is aggressively adopting single-use technologies (SUTs) and continuous bioprocessing to cut down setup times, mitigate cross-contamination risks, and optimize manufacturing yields.

Regional Insights

  • North America: Holds the lion's share of the global market, propelled by heavy R&D investments,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and a high concentration of leading biopharmaceutical giants and CDMOs.
  • Europe: Represents a mature, highly regulated market with substantial growth fueled by a robust biosimilar framework and major manufacturing hubs in countries like Germany, Switzerland, and Ireland.
  • Asia-Pacific: Positioned as the fastest-growing region, APAC benefits from expanding biopharma infrastructure in China, India, and South Korea, cost-effective manufacturing operations, and supportive government initiatives.
